Compare all specifications:
1950 Holden FX | 2005 Pontiac GTO | |
Make | Holden | Pontiac |
Model | FX | GTO |
Year Released | 1950 | 2005 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2165 cc | 5965 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 51 HP | 400 HP |
Torque | 136 Nm | 536 Nm |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Vehicle Weight | 970 kg | 1690 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4380 mm | 4830 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1710 mm | 1850 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1580 mm | 1400 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2620 mm | 2800 mm |
